IND vs NAM Live streaming details, when & where to watch India vs Namibia T20 World Cup 2026 match 18

The IND vs NAM match will take place on February 12.

India are set to face Namibia in their next game of the T20 World Cup 2026. Both sides are placed in Group A in the tournament and will clash on February 12 (Thursday).

The Suryakumar Yadav & Co. won their opening game by 29 runs, defending a 161-run total. Namibia lost their first game against the Netherlands by seven wickets. Both teams have played one T20I match in the past during the T20 World Cup 2021, which India won by nine wickets.

Also Read: IND vs NAM: 3 records that could be broken tonight in match 18 of T20 World Cup 2026

Ahead of the match, India have suffered a big blow as their opener Abhishek Sharma is highly likely to miss the game. He is recovering from a stomach issue. Ishan Kishan also sustained an injury during the warm-up session, and it remains to be seen if he will play against Namibia.

However, Jasprit Bumrah and Washington Sundar have regained their fitness, and their comeback will be a big boost for the team.

On the other hand, Gerhard Erasmus-led Namibia will face a strong challenge against India. Despite fewer hopes for victory, they will leave no stone unturned to showcase a strong performance against the Men-in-Blue.

Ahead of the IND vs NAM clash, below are the live telecast, live streaming, match time, venue, and toss details.

IND vs NAM Head-to-Head Record in T20Is

  • Matches Played: 1
  • India Won: 1
  • Namibia Won: 0

IND vs NAM ICC T20 World Cup 2026- Match Details

  • Match: India vs Namibia, Group A, ICC T20 World Cup 2026, Match 18
  • Date: Thursday, February 12, 2026
  • Time: 7:00 PM IST / 1:30 PM GMT / 7:00 PM Local time
  • Venue: Arun Jaitley Stadium, Delhi
  • Toss Time: 6:30 PM IST / 1:00 PM GMT/ 6:30 PM Local time

When to watch IND vs NAM ICC T20 World Cup 2026? Timing Details

The IND vs NAM match will take place on February 12 (Thursday) at the Arun Jaitley Stadium in Delhi. The game will start at 7 PM IST in India. In Namibia, the match will start at 3:30 PM CAT (Central African Time). The toss will take place 30 minutes before the encounter.

How to watch the IND vs NAM ICC T20 World Cup 2026 match in India?

The encounter will be televised on Star Sports Network in India. Live streaming will be available on the JioStar app and website.

How to watch the IND vs NAM ICC T20 World Cup 2026 match in Namibia?

The live telecast and live streaming of the match will be available on SuperSports Network in Namibia.
